In Krasny Luch, on the eve of pseudo-referendum provider switched off Ukrainian TV channels

14.05.2014, 16:22

On May 10, in the city of Krasny Luch (population around 100 thousand) of Luhansk oblast on the eve of the pseudo-referendum about the status of the region a local cable TV provider, the TV and radio company 'Luch', switched off several Ukrainian TV channels in its network, in particular, ICTV, TRK Ukraina, STB, and Channel 112. About a week earlier, this provider switched off the First National TV Channel, 1+1, Channel 5, and Channel 24. Instead of the Ukrainian TV channels, it broadcasts Russian TV channels. According to the TV and radio company 'Luch', it switched off the Ukrainian channels in connection with the recent events in the East of Ukraine, as they are now Luhansk People's Republic.

For the context, on May 11 in Luhansk oblast the separatists conducted referendum about the status of the region
